Problem Opening or Closing Your Mouth



Experiencing trouble opening or shutting your mouth is a clear indication that you should get in touch with a dental specialist promptly. This sign can be an indication of various underlying oral wellness issues that require prompt interest.

-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) Disorder: TMJ disorder influences the joint that attaches your jawbone to your head. It can create discomfort and rigidity, making it difficult to move your jaw.

- Lockjaw: Lockjaw, also known as trismus, is a condition where the jaw muscles spasm and avoid normal mouth opening.

- Dental Cancer: Trouble in mouth motion can be an early indicator of oral cancer cells. It's critical to get it examined by a dental specialist.

- Infection: An infection in the oral cavity or salivary glands can create swelling and difficulty in mouth movement.

- Injury: Injury to the jaw or face can lead to issues with jaw activity.

If you experience problem opening up or closing your mouth, do not postpone seeking specialist aid from an oral doctor.

Clicking or Standing Out Jaw Joint



Do you experience a hitting or popping feeling in your jaw joint? This could be an indication that you require to get in touch with an oral surgeon promptly.

Clicking or popping in the jaw joint, likewise known as the temporomandibular joint (TMJ), can indicate a problem with the joint's placement or function. It may be triggered by conditions such as TMJ disorder, arthritis, or a displaced disc in the joint.

This clicking or popping can lead to pain, pain, and problem in opening or closing your mouth. If left neglected, it can worsen and impact your daily life.

Therefore, it is necessary to seek the competence of an oral cosmetic surgeon that can detect the underlying reason and offer ideal treatment alternatives to minimize your symptoms and stop further complications.
